The debate over whether to change the House rules to limit the minority party’s influence is expected to come up Thursday.

Democratic leaders are considering changing House rules to make it harder for Republicans to spring surprise procedural votes on the majority after several embarrassing incidents on the floor in recent weeks.revising the House rules to require Republicans give them more notice on specific procedural votes, known as a “motion to recommit,” a wonky tactic that the GOP has used to force Democrats to vote on a range of controversial issues since January.

Hours after Hoyer floated the idea, Democrats suffered another surprising defeat when Republicans were successfully able to modify the bill requiring background checks on all gun sales — a marquee vote in the new Democratic-led House — with a provision targeting undocumented immigrants who try to purchase weapons.Sign Up

Democrats learned the specifics of the GOP motion only minutes before the vote, following the long-standing House rule, causing a dash on the floor. Many Democrats held off on voting as they spoke with other members and leadership, though the bill ultimately passed. Afterward, a small group of Democratic whip members and aides huddled on the floor for more than 15 minutes, with Rep. Dan Kildee appearing to shout as House Majority Whip Jim Clyburn looked on.
